01/31/2025
It's been quiet here. The platform shrinks, the numbers get lower and the power of influence fades.
What once was is no longer, and what could be lingers in the future.
Snow falls, the sun rises, and time passes.
2025's word has slowly made its way to the surface.
Release - Let Go. "Be still and KNOW that I am God."
The Hebrew word here is rāp̄â, which means to sink, withdraw, relax, let go, abate, abandon, drop.
2025 is calling me to do just that. Rapa - release.
- Release what I thought would be.
- Release people and relationships.
- Release my expectations.
- Release fear.
- Release shame and regret.
- Release what was.
- Release beliefs and teachings.
- Release my failures and shortcomings.
-Release what others think of me and say about me
In order to know God properly, I can't hold on to so many of these things we all tend to hold tightly to.
While I focus on releasing, I will embrace the gifts that I have.
Family: I have the best—Jason, my beautiful kids, and grand babies.
Friends: The ones that stick no matter what.
Faith: The small mustard seed kind.
Community: The space I live and new friendships were formed.
The lessons I've learned and am learning on the journey.
2025, a whole month in, I pray will be one of release and freedom to know God better and more. To grow and move forward in places where I have been stuck and paralyzed.
